1998 The first Decor&You franchise opened in Prospect, Connecticut.
1998 Mary Gilliatt joins Decor&You as an advisor to guide training and design initiatives.
1999 Decor&You becomes a hit and opens a second franchise in Rockland County, NY.
2001 Paul Pieschel joins the Decor&You executive team to strengthen sales and marketing operations
for the growing company.
2001 Decor&You creates a permanent home for its national training center in Southbury, Connecticut.
2003 Entrepreneur Magazine ranks Decor&You among its Top 500 Franchises for the first time.
2004 Decor&You establishes the Decor&You Foundation dedicated to supporting people and their
pets.
2005 Decor&You opens its first west coast franchise in California.
2005 Decor&You begins hiring professional managers to enhance key franchise functions: coaching,
training, vendor relations, communications and operations.
2006 Decor&You awards its 100th franchise.
2006 Linda Gottlieb joins Decor&You to refine franchisee training and expands and strengthens the
franchisee education curriculum and the faculty.
2006 Frank Spano joins the Decor&You Executive Team to lead strategic development.
2006 Decor&You begins providing design industry certification to graduating franchisees, in
partnership with Certified Interior Decorators International, the nation’s only certifying body
for interior decorating professionals.
2007 Decor&You partners to create the FabriClutch™, a revolution in fabric merchandising that simplifies and enhances the fabric selling and shopping experience for decorators and consumers alike.
2007 Decor&You awards it's first Multi-Unit Territory Director franchise in Virginia.
2007 Decor&You appears in articles in the nation’s three leading daily newspapers: The Washington
Post, The Wall Street Journal and The New York Times.
2007 Decor&You wins the Mercury Gold Award for Outstanding Internal Communications for its
2006 National Franchisee Conference, “Dressed for Success,” from the PRSA Chapters of
Connecticut and Westchester County.
2008 Eight more Multi-Unit Territory Director franchises are awarded nationwide.
2008 Decor&You celebrates their10 Year Anniversary in Las Vegas style, while taking the World Market
Center by storm.
The Decor&You Charitable Foundation
In 2005, Decor&You and its franchisees established the Decor&You Charitable Foundation. It is a private 501(c)(3) organization that embraces the sentimental tradition of supporting charities that improve the lives of families and their pets.
Each year, the franchise conducts a fundraising event at its annual conference, and donates proceeds to two designated charities. Dozens of Decor&You suppliers contribute decorating products worth thousands of dollars for a silent auction. During the past two years, the following organizations have been beneficiaries of more than $10,000 in donations: Armed Forces Children’s Education Fund, Noah’s Wish, Katrina Disaster Relief, and Military Working Dog Foundation.

Karen Powell, along with business partners who she met while managing a top-ten ranking sales team for Transdesigns (a national home decorating company) launched their own independent interior decorating business called Décor & More, in 1995. It was concluded that this business concept would best be implemented by a network of franchisees, who would function as full-time entrepreneurs, committed to growing and developing individual decorating businesses to their fullest potential. Franchising also offered a proven path for the partners to expand nationally and internationally while protecting and building the brand and securing the integrity of the system. The partners set to work perfecting systems and training programs, developing a replicable system for decorators or managers to open, operate, and build successful interior decorating businesses.
On that basis, in January 1998, that perfected interior decorating business system was franchised with the establishment of the Decor&You®, Inc. Franchise Program. The structure of Decor&You responded robustly to economic trends in the 90’s and the nature of the changing workforce in the decorating industry.
In less than a decade the company grew to merit inclusion among the top 500 franchise opportunities in the U.S., for four years in a row, as ranked by Entrepreneur Magazine. Today, Decor&You stands as the second largest interior decorating products and services franchise in the U.S., with more than 100 decorators in 30 states.

Mary Gilliatt, International Design Advisor
The influence of Mary Gilliatt and her treasury of design industry resource books, nearing 40 volumes, permeates Decor&You with the authenticity of great design and a global point of view. Mary first became associated with the franchise in its earliest days, when she joined as Design Director. The Decorating Book, published in 1981, helped secure Mary’s position of international fame and has since been translated into eight languages and sold three million copies worldwide. In 2004 she published Mary Gilliatt’s Dictionary of Architecture & Interior Design, an essential desk reference for anyone who works in or writes about the engaging world of design.
Mary Gilliatt currently sits on the advisory board of the leading design school in America, the New York School of Interior Design, which is proposing to launch the first interior design college in Dubai. Decor&You is fortunate to have Mary Gilliatt on its training faculty, where each year she teaches several classes of trainees. Mary also consults year-round with Decor&You franchisees on individual client decorating plans, to enhance capabilities and maximize beautiful results.
